Embolisation therapy for pulmonary arteriovenous malformations.

Charlie C-T Hsu1, Gigi Nc Kwan, Shane A Thompson

  • 1The Alfred Hospital, Commercial Road, Prahran, Victoria, Australia, 3181.

The Cochrane Database of Systematic Reviews
|May 14, 2010
PubMed
Summary

No randomized controlled trials were found for pulmonary arteriovenous malformation embolization. Observational data suggest embolization therapy is beneficial, reducing mortality and morbidity compared to no treatment.

Area of Science:

  • Vascular Medicine
  • Interventional Radiology

Background:

  • Pulmonary arteriovenous malformations (PAVMs) are abnormal vascular connections causing right-to-left shunts.
  • PAVMs lead to significant morbidity and mortality, primarily due to paradoxical emboli, stroke, and hemorrhage.
  • Embolization therapy aims to occlude feeding arteries to PAVMs, preventing serious complications.

Purpose of the Study:

  • To evaluate the efficacy and safety of embolization therapy for PAVMs.
  • To compare embolization with surgical resection and different embolization devices.

Main Methods:

  • Searched multiple clinical trial registries and databases up to November 2009.
  • Included randomized controlled trials comparing embolization to no treatment, surgery, or other devices.
  • Eligibility assessed by independent reviewers.

Main Results:

  • No randomized controlled trials (RCTs) were identified in the search.
  • Consequently, no statistical analysis could be performed.

Conclusions:

  • Currently, no RCTs support or refute embolization for PAVMs.
  • Observational studies indicate embolization therapy reduces mortality and morbidity.
  • Registry studies and future RCTs comparing devices are recommended to strengthen evidence.
